Thread: Mig 210 Spool gun problem fixed; READ

  1. Default Mig 210 Spool gun problem fixed; READ

    I was having all kinds of erratic burn back and bead issues welding 1/4” AL. After checking everything, I took the gun apart and found the problem. The drive gear on the feeder motor was not tight and let the wire slip and even stop feeding altogether, at times. As you can imagine having a very inconsistent wire speed makes it impossible to get a decent weld. I cleaned off the shaft and put the gear back with some green (wick n loc) loctite. Now welding AL is almost too easy.
    FWIW, when looking for the problem, I held the feeder wheel and it would actually stop if I held too hard. Then is when I thought it was either a bad motor or something was slipping.
    Hope this helps if you're not happy with welding AL. It may be the gun and not you.
